As a leader in engineering design and information management solutions to the Oil & Gas industry, AVEVA is keen to contribute to the debate and to fully understand the role of Information Systems within Health & Safety.

 

As such we would like to invite you to come along to our engaging event to be held at Aberdeen Business School on the evening of Thursday, 1st September 18:00 for 18.30 start.   The purpose of this event is to showcase the findings of an independent study carried out by researchers at Robert Gordon University, in order to provide the industry as a whole with  a better understanding of the role information management plays in managing health and safety in the Oil & Gas Industry. The research also explores how organisations achieve improvements in health and safety performance based on factors that range from culture to technology.

 

Hosted by Jeremy Cresswell, editor of the Press and Journal’s ENERGY supplement and honorary Professor at RGU’s Business School, the evening will commence with a presentation of the report’s findings by Professor Rita Marcella, Dean of Aberdeen Business School.
